I accidentally release the bolt-sleeve lock plunger on my newly acquired Turk 38 (Kirkale large ring small shank)... without first putting it into the "dissasemble" position (with the safetly in the vertical position). Now I can't put the bolt back into the barreled action (I have the thing stripped down), and I can't unscrew the bolt-sleeve.

HELP!!! What can I do to fix this???

If I understand correctly, you uncocked the bolt while it was outside the receiver. With the safety in the fire position, (laying to the left). If this is the case, you must simply cock the bolt by hand back into the fire position. Grap the shroud with one hand and the bolt body with the other and twist.
